LBJ10 replied to the topic Could it be e cuniculi???? (PT 2) in the forum HOUSE RABBIT Q & A 2 years, 4 months ago
Does your vet treat a lot of rabbits? Some vets will just treat on suspicion since EC is notoriously frustrating when it comes to testing. Treatment is relatively inexpensive and really won’t hurt anything IF the bunny doesn’t actually have EC. As Dana said though, it can take weeks to see improvement after continuous treatment. DanaNM replied to the topic Could it be e cuniculi???? (PT 2) in the forum HOUSE RABBIT Q & A 2 years, 4 months ago
Urinary incontinence is also a huge symptom of EC. That along with the other symptoms (especially the head tilt) would push me to complete the EC treatment. It can take several weeks to see improvement, the full course is 28 days (also feel free to post her med amounts here so we can double check, I had a vet underdosing Panacur at one point).

Bam replied to the topic Rabbit giving mixed signals in the forum DIET & CARE 2 years, 4 months ago
Sometimes rabbits do pass a few stuck together poop. It’s ok if its only a few and the rest of the poop is fine. It’s great that you noticed it though!
